Panama City is the economic and financial center of Central America and one of the most developed cities in Latin America. Known for its modern skyline, international banking sector, and strategic location connecting North and South America, the city attracts entrepreneurs, investors, and expats from around the world. Panama City offers a high standard of living, modern infrastructure, and a favorable territorial tax system that appeals to international professionals and remote workers.
